The essential technique is similar like the final lesson besides undeniable fact that we've got added a counter which counts between 0000 and 9999. Our counter increments with 1 second delay. Like in the final Lesson, nr.07, we are going to work with CCP1 in PWM mode, to manage the luminous depth of a L.E.D, but here we will not use buttons to fluctuate the width type of our signal. Done by: ' Aureliu Raducu Macovei, 2010. ' Description: ' In this experiment we are going to work with one-wire communication. Lesson nr.12: ' Multiplexed 7Segment as counter mode ' Done by: ' Aureliu Raducu Macovei, 2010. ' Description: ' This code demonstrates displaying number on four 7-section show (frequent ' cathode), in multiplex mode.

Lesson nr.11: ' 7Segment in multiplexed mode ' Written by: ' Aureliu Raducu Macovei, 2010. ' Description: ' In this experiment we will present how you can implement the multiplexed mode ' to regulate 7 segmnet digits. Electric scheme emphasize multiplexing interconnection mode. The multiplexing circuit is configured on the breadboard, being composed of four NPN transistor and a few resistance.

The temperature value might be displayed on 4 digits-with 7 segment, in multiplexed mod after all. Pull-up resistor (with a value of 4.7 k), is required to carry out communication between the sensor and microcontroller. The thermal sensor used is "DS18B20" and measured worth is displayed ' on the 7-phase digits. 4. Data wire from DS18B20 is conected to RA4. 4. ' Data wire from DS18B20 is conected to RA4. Lesson nr.14: ' Digital thermometer with DS18B20 and 7- Segments. On this Lesson, we'll make a digital temperature meter using DS18B20. The connection between temperature sensor and microcontroller will probably be carried out through a single wire.

All 7-section displays are linked to PORTB (RB0..RB7, phase A to RB0, phase B to RB1, and many others.) with refresh through pins RA0..RA3 on PORTA. All 7-segment shows are connected to PORTB ' (RB0..RB7, phase A to RB0, section B to RB1, and many others.) with refresh by way of pins ' RA0..RA3 on PORTA.